"Dieliekevi Tsalida" is written in , a Tibeto-Burman language spoken primarily by the Angami tribe in the Kohima district of Nagaland, a state in Northeast India.

Generally published by the Angami Baptist Church Council (ABCC) through authorized printing partners in Nagaland/Assam. Rivenburg J
